A Uniform Gifts to Minors Act (UGMA) account is a custodial account created for minors that allows for the transfer of assets such as cash, securities, and other investments.
Key Features
- Custodial account for minors
- Allows transfer of assets to minors
- Can hold various types of investments
Pros
- Provides a way to transfer assets to minors
- Allows for tax savings as income generated from the account is taxed at the minor's rate
- Can be used for a variety of investment purposes
Cons
- Limited control over the account by the minor until they reach the age of majority
- Assets in the account are considered irrevocable gifts to the minor
